#e30fad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e30fad is composed of 89% red, 5.9%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 23.8%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 315.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 47.5%. #e30fad color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#c7005b.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#e30fad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e30fad has RGB values of R:227, G:15,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.24,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14880685.

Shades and Tints of #e30fad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060005 is the darkest color, while #fef3fb is the lightest one.
